Today started out cooler than Tuesday but ended up a little warmer in the low sixties. The wind was much calmer too. I took advantage of the nice sunny afternoon to get some more experience with my new Sony Alpha 6000 camera.

I took the camera and the 55-210mm lens to the Wetlands Park for some practice with the longer lens. I took about 40 pictures of various things. The wildlife was a little less visible today than on past visits. I suspect the overall cooler temperatures are keeping the birds back in the reeds. I continue to appreciate the speed of this camera. The time to compose, auto focus and expose is much quicker than my point and shoot. I almost got a good stop action shot of a duck landing in the pond. The sun angle combined with my slow reaction time didn’t help the shot, but I wouldn’t have had a chance with my point and shoot. The following are some of the pictures I took.
